RESERVE BLUEJAY MEN FALL IN HEARTBREAKER AT KANSAS WESLEYAN

SALINA, Kan. – The Tabor College Reserve Men's Basketball team headed up north to Salina last night to take on Kansas Wesleyan University's Reserve team. The Bluejays were coming off a nail-biting win over Ottawa University almost two weeks ago, while the Coyotes were coming off a loss at Bethel College last Wednesday.
 
The first half would prove to be an exciting affair, as it would end with both teams tied at 33 apiece. The Bluejays were led in scoring in the first half by Creighton Kukula with nine, while Hayden Lucas had eight, Drew Wertenberger and Langston Taylor each had five, and Jordy Dolloff, Fate Thiel, and Kam Kaniper each had two. 
 
The second half would prove to be just as tight, with the Coyotes ultimately pulling away to win by four, 85-81. Kukula and Wertenberger led the Bluejays in scoring with 23 points each, Lucas finished with 11, Dolloff and Taylor each had nine, while Kaniper, Thiel, and Shan Williams each had two. 
 
Head Reserve Coach Ethan Gager had this to say about his team's effort, "I'm Proud of the way we competed for 40 minutes, we did some good things tonight, just a few small miscues that we need to work to clean up. Can't dwell on this one though, all we can do is begin preparing for Sterling and make sure we're ready for the next one."
